Raipur, April 12, 2013: Main opposition Congress today launched its Parivartan Yatra from north of Chhattisgarh to unseat the BJP government in the state and demanded the regime to stop using the photograph of its Chief Minister in Central schemes.
AICC General Secretary B K Hariprasad and AICC Treasurer Motilal Vora took the leadership in launching the programme from Ambikapur, the district headquarters of Sarguja amid an impressive gathering.
The people of Chhattisgarh would no longer tolerate BJP rule in the state, looking into its bad track record and corruption in welfare schemes, Congress leaders said.
The state BJP government was pasting the photographs of its Chief Minister or ministers in the centrally sponsored schemes, which should immediately be stopped, Chhattisgarh PCC President Nand Kumar Patel told a meeting later at Balrampur.
Union Minister Charan Das Mahant and veteran leader Vidya Charan Shukla also addressed the gathering.
